1.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

What is the Simple Future Tense?

Back

The Simple Future Tense is used to describe actions that will happen at a later time. It is formed using 'will' + base form of the verb.

2.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

How do you form a negative sentence in Simple Future Tense?

Back

To form a negative sentence in Simple Future Tense, use 'will not' or its contraction 'won't' before the base form of the verb.

3.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

What is the structure of a question in Simple Future Tense?

Back

The structure is 'Will + subject + base form of the verb?' For example, 'Will you go to the party?'

4.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

Provide an example of a positive sentence in Simple Future Tense.

Back

I will finish my homework.

5.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

Provide an example of a negative sentence in Simple Future Tense.

Back

She will not attend the meeting.

6.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

Provide an example of a question in Simple Future Tense.

Back

Will they play soccer tomorrow?

7.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

What is the contraction of 'will not'?

Back

The contraction of 'will not' is 'won't'.
